PZZ540 Coastal Waters From Point Arena To Point Reyes California Out To 10 Nm- 228 Pm Pdt Mon Mar 9 2026

.gale warning in effect through Tuesday afternoon - .

This afternoon - NW wind 20 to 25 kt, rising to 25 to 30 kt late. Seas 9 to 12 ft. Wave detail: nw 11 ft at 10 seconds.

Tonight - NW wind 25 to 30 kt. Seas 9 to 12 ft. Wave detail: nw 11 ft at 10 seconds.

Tue - NW wind 25 to 30 kt. Seas 8 to 11 ft. Wave detail: nw 10 ft at 10 seconds.

Tue night - NW wind 25 to 30 kt, easing to 20 to 25 kt after midnight. Seas 8 to 11 ft, subsiding to 7 to 9 ft after midnight. Wave detail: nw 10 ft at 9 seconds.

Wed - N wind 15 to 20 kt, becoming nw 10 to 15 kt in the afternoon. Seas 5 to 8 ft. Wave detail: nw 8 ft at 10 seconds.

Wed night - NW wind 15 to 20 kt. Seas 5 to 7 ft. Wave detail: nw 7 ft at 9 seconds.

Thu - N wind 10 to 15 kt, becoming nw 15 to 20 kt in the afternoon. Seas 5 to 6 ft. Wave detail: nw 6 ft at 9 seconds and S 2 ft at 19 seconds.

Thu night - NW wind 15 to 20 kt. Seas 5 to 7 ft. Wave detail: nw 7 ft at 8 seconds and S 2 ft at 18 seconds.

Fri - NW wind 15 to 20 kt. Seas 5 to 7 ft. Wave detail: nw 6 ft at 9 seconds and S 2 ft at 17 seconds.

Fri night - NW wind 20 to 25 kt. Seas 6 to 8 ft. Wave detail: nw 7 ft at 8 seconds and S 2 ft at 16 seconds.
PZZ500 228 Pm Pdt Mon Mar 9 2026

Synopsis for the central california coast and bays including the Monterey bay - Greater farallones - .and cordell bank national marine sanctuaries - .
the gradient between strong high pressure in the eastern pacific and lower pressure over california is supporting strong to near gale force nw winds across the exposed coastal waters. These winds are building very rough seas of 12-15 feet. Gale conditions will continue through late Tuesday night before decreasing to a fresh to strong nw breeze for the rest of the week.

FXUS66 KSTO 091957 AFDSTO

Area Forecast Discussion National Weather Service Sacramento CA 1257 PM PDT Mon Mar 9 2026


KEY MESSAGES

- Dry and warm weather prevails, with slightly cooler yet still above-normal temperatures on Tuesday.

- Well-above normal high temperatures expected Thursday onward, with areas of Minor HeatRisk in the Valley.

DISCUSSION

...Today-Tuesday...
Temperatures will remain above-normal today as westerly flow continues aloft and ridging builds over the Eastern Pacific.
A slight "cool down" is expected on Tuesday as ridging continues to flatten out over Northern California, however temperatures will still be a few degrees above normal. Winds will be light, with occasionally breezy onshore flow through the Delta and southern Sacramento Valley this evening.

...Wednesday-Sunday...
Ridging begins to strengthen and build over Northern California by mid week, and is on track to dominate the synoptic pattern through Sunday. Temperatures will climb well above-normal, with Minor HeatRisk returning to the Valley Thursday onward. The NBM is indicating a 60 to 90% chance of Valley high temperatures greater than 80 degrees Wednesday through Sunday. Warmer overnight lows compared to seasonal averages are expected during this time as well. Relative humidities will also trend lower, especially over the mountains and foothills with minimum values in the 20s teens to low 30s.

Be sure to take extra precautions against heat related illnesses when spending time outside. Additionally, locally water ways are still running cold so be sure to practice cold water safety if spending time on the water this week.


AVIATION
VFR conditions are expected through the next 24 hours, with winds at 5-10kts. Light and variable winds expected during the overnight hours. Cloud development around 04-06z and continuing through 15-17z. There is a slight chance for lower clouds to develop as well, but that is around a 15-20 percent chance at this time.

STO WATCHES/WARNINGS/ADVISORIES
None.
